PUBG Early Access Patch Notes May 16th, 2017
Good morning everyone. There is a PUBG Early Access Week 8 Patch coming tomorrow (5/16/17). The test servers should be updated today(5/15/17) at some point.
UPDATE 9am CST, Live servers are now live with this week’s patch!
Here is our breakdown of the changes in the order that I consider important:
- Lag Switch as well as other Anti Cheat measures added.
- Bug fixes to correct the issue with your character getting stuck in objects such as boxes.
- Flash bang removed temporarily to resolve the issue with causing disconnects.
- Improvements on FPS drops while in a vehicle.
- Custom Games fix due to rain and various other sound changes.

Early Access – Week 8 Patch Notes
Client Performances Improvements
- Slightly improved the drop in FPS when driving vehicles
Anti Cheat
- In order to prevent using “lag switch” to cheat, the characters will now be locked and will not be able to move, rotate and attack others when the ping exceeds a certain value
- You will no longer be able to remove the environment foliage by revising the .ini file
Custom Games
- Fixed the issue that was causing the sound to break when there are too many vehicles in a small area
Bug Fixes
- Partially fixed a bug that caused the character to get stuck in different objects in the environment
- Partially fixed a bug that caused the game client to freeze
- Fixed a bug that caused the crosshair to still be visible while in no-UI mode
- Temporarily removed the flash bang from the game as it was causing game clients to freeze/crash
